Decline “fortis, forte” (strong, brave; m/f) in the singular.

A
  • Nominative: fortis
  • Genitive: fortis
  • Dative: fortī
  • Accusative: fortem
  • Ablative: fortī

Decline “ācer, ācris, ācre” (keen, severe, fierce) in the masculine/feminine singular.

A
  • Nominative: ācer, m.; ācris, f.
  • Genitive: ācris
  • Dative: ācrī
  • Accusative: ācrem
  • Ablative: ācrī

Decline “ācer, ācris, ācre” (keen, severe, fierce) in the neuter plural.

A
  • Nominative: ācria
  • Genitive: ācrium
  • Dative: ācribus
  • Accusative: ācria
  • Ablative: ācribus

State the plural declentions of “fortis, forte” (strong, brave; m/f).

A
  • Nominative: fortēs
  • Genitive: fortium
  • Dative: fortibus
  • Accusative: fortēs
  • Ablative: fortibus

What are the declentions of “fortis, forte” (n. sg.)?

A
  • Nominative: forte
  • Genitive: fortis
  • Dative: fortī
  • Accusative: forte
  • Ablative: fortī

The declentions of “fortis, forte” (strong, brave; n. pl.) are…

A
  • Nominative: fortia
  • Genitive: fortium
  • Dative: fortibus
  • Accusative: fortia
  • Ablative: fortibus

List the declentions of “ācer, ācris, ācre” (keen, severe, fierce) in the neuter singular.

A
  • Nominative: ācre
  • Genitive: ācris
  • Dative: ācrī
  • Accusative: ācre
  • Ablative: ācrī

Decline “potēns, gen. potentis” in the masculine/feminine singular.

A
  • Nominative: potēns
  • Genitive: potentis
  • Dative: potentī
  • Accusative: potentem
  • Ablative: potentī

State the declentions of “potēns, gen. potentis” in the masculine/feminine plural.

A
  • Nominative: potentēs
  • Genitive: potentium
  • Dative: potentibus
  • Accusative: potentēs
  • Ablative: potentibus
